摘要:

An externally heated copper vapor laser using a carbon tubular heater is described. A recrystallized alumina tube of 20‐mm inner diameter is used as the laser tube, which is located inside the tubular heater. When the heating power of the carbon heater is 3 kW, the temperature of the laser tube is 1600 °C. The average laser output power is measured to be 1.2 W at a laser tube temperature of 1500 °C when the charging voltage to the energy storage capacitor is 5 kV, the pulse repetition rate is 5 kHz, and the Ne gas fill pressure is 10 Torr.
